The icon with the up arrow at the rear of the car is part of the self leveling suspension system. This button allows you to manually raise the rear of the vehicle to increase departure angle, etc. I have also used it to tilt the rear end of a trailer down for easier loading. If you hold the button pressed you should be able to see the movement of the rear by looking out the rear view mirrors. It really only works under certain conditions which I can't quite remember. I think maybe the vehicle has to be stopped to raise the rear, not sure about lowering it again. I know that it will lower itself at around 25 MPH. Read the description in your owners manual. Also, you can get a special remote to allow you to lower the rear to ease in hooking up trailers.
